Mosaic tribute to one of my favorite spots in Philadelphia - a full city block surrounded by a wall that serves as a canvas for some of the city's greatest urban artists. Graffiti is such a controversial subject and concept. I am a 50-something white woman who absolutely loves the form, am drawn to it, loves the colors and expression of it, even the anger of it when it's there. But then, as you can see by many of the photos in my stream, I am drawn the reality of deep urban living....

 

This wall gets painted over from time to time and new pieces of art go up and I never tire of going by it. Recently I have been sensitive to the fact that, out of respect for the artists, we not identify the location of their art. My recent posts reflect only the city where they are found, and I am trying to go back through my photos and omit locations where I put them (I suppose in my enthusiasm for how wonderful the stuff is, I stated location so that others might go find it). Though I must say that this block is kind of an unofficial official urban art space, it might not offend as much.

 

This location is different, now, as it has been identified in one of Philadelphia's weekly newspapers, Philadelphia Weekly, in the current issue. It seems that a developer has bought the land, at Germantown Ave. & Cecil B. More, and {gulp} townhouses are coming. Maybe it's f*cked, but I'm a little sad about this news. And I can't help but think that these creative canvases will be replaced by random tags on the walls of the new houses.

 

I will never think that this stuff ISN'T art - just look at the colors, the complicated design, the whimsy, the lettering, the caricature - whatever they choose to do - and much of it is actually stunning.

Located on 174th street in The Bronx. In the 1970's and 1980's the buildings here housed the meat packing industry. Just a matter of time before it is converted to apartment complexes and townhomes.

Newly whitewashed wall with new art being created,by DS3 an original Graffiti Artist from New York City in the 1980's.

 

His work has been seen in the movie "The Warriors", "Style Wars" and in several Graffiti Books, he is one of the original train "bombing" graffiti artist from back in the day.

In the recent protests in the city of Isfahan, system forces fired at the people with a shotgun and blinded a number of protesters!

A number of mothers who lost their children in similar protests bandaged one eye in solidarity with the injured,they have a photo of their killed child with them.

This is my mental image of what happened recently, to those who have paid an irreparable price for justice and #human dignity.
